Lekki Shootings: Senate Spokesperson Accuses Buhari of lackadaisical attitude Over EndSARS protest

The Senate spokesperson, Senator Ajibola Basiru has blamed President Muhammadu Buhari for the shooting by suspected Military personnel at Lekki toll gate that led to death of scores of EndSARS protesters in Lagos State .

The Federal lawmaker, who is representing Osun Central senatorial district in a statement signed by his media Media Adviser Remi Ibitola, said the lackadaisical attitude of the Federal Executive lingered to anarchy and destruction of lives and property.

He further statement that the Senate had on Tuesday resolved that the President should address the nation, saying not knowing that the evening of that day will bring about more sinister dimensions to the already deteriorated situation.

According to him, “I have monitored with shock and personal indignation the turn out of events on the #EndSARS protest with evidence of obvious descent of the country, particularly in the Southwest of Nigeria, after the reckless and disturbing incident at Lekki toll gate yesterday evening.

“As a student who was involved in several protests, I see no reason for the display of outright recklessness by shooting into unarmed protesters by whoever, governmental or otherwise.

“As an elected representative of the people of Osun Central in the Senate, I deprecate the clear lackadaisical attitude of the Federal Executive to the lingering anarchy and destruction of lives and property.

“By section 14 of our Constitution security and welfare of the people is the paramount purpose of government.

“I hereby urge the President to live up to the Constitution and find a lasting, peaceful and human friendly solution to the crisis and also comply with the several resolutions of the National Assembly.

“I find it personally uncomfortable to keep silent anymore as an elected representative of the people whose youths are been killed and bruised”. he said
